Back in 
August, when I complained about presentation errors, I made a mistake of my own in the post.  It turns out I was following Muphry's Law, which states that "if you write anything criticizing 
editing or 
proofreading, there will be a fault of some kind in what you have written."  
Muphry is a deliberate misspelling of Murphy.
